Jack Dempsey Eaton

Jack Dempsey Eaton, 91 of Holden, Missouri passed away Tuesday, March 21, 2023 at his home.

Jack was born February 18, 1932 in Iconium, Missouri, son of Jesse Sanford Eaton and Ruth Ann (Anglin) Eaton.
He was raised in Iconium. He worked briefly at the Kansas City Stockyards.

Following the stockyards, Jack was employed with Manor Bread at Westport, where he met the love of his life, Jean. He was united in marriage to Doris Jean Wilhoit on September 26, 1953 in Independence.

Jack had resided near Holden for the past 33 years. He was a union baker by trade. Upon retired from the Bakery and Confectionary Union, he went to work for Sheffield Nut & Bolt in Kansas City, from where he would retire.

Jack enjoyed field trials with beagles, tractor pulls, but mostly, faithfully attending his children’s and grandchildren’s sporting events throughout the years. In retirement, he loved watching and feeding Johnson County humming birds. Jack was known for making the most amazing and beautiful rolls.
